How We Met & Our First Date

We met in a 'modern' way, on Tinder! We instantly hit it off once we realized our obsession with certain movies and TV shows. I actually started watching Dexter so I could have something to chat about since Alex had raved about it so much. After 2 weeks of texting, we decided to grab dinner. We went to Firebirds and stayed for hours talking over beer and good steak. One thing that stood out to me about the date was that at the end of the night, it started raining, and Alex made me wait inside and pulled his car to the front of the restaurant because he didn't want my hair to get ruined.

How He Proposed

We had hiked Pigeon Island in St. Lucia 2 years ago, with my little sister. He took a panoramic picture of it and printed it on a canvas for above our fireplace as my Christmas Present. Little did I know, he was scheming the whole time to propose at that very spot whenever we returned. The first day on the beach when we returned to St. Lucia, Alex pressed to go hike that very spot. We went up, and chilled at the top while a couple of people were taking pictures (Turns out he was stalling and waiting for them to leave). He made me pose for a picture at the tallest rock, and then got down on one knee. It was intimate, thoughtful, and such a SURPRISE! I can't even remember if I said "yes" or not, I was smiling and crying so hard!
